A novel fluoride ion colorimetric chemosensor.

Hyoung Min Yeo1, Byung Ju Ryu, Kye Chun Nam.   

Abstract

A novel phosphonium derivative of naphthalene was synthesized by the reaction of 1,8-dibromomethylnaphthalene with triphenylphosphine, which only showed a distinct color change when treated with fluoride ions.
